What You Need to Know
Screen cleaners contain isopropyl alcohol and surfactants. Low toxicity overall. A lick of cleaned screen surface is harmless.

What should I do if my dog eats screen cleaner?
Monitor your dog for any unusual symptoms. If symptoms develop, contact your veterinarian for guidance.
